What Does 10W Mean?

Before diving into whether a 10W speaker is loud, it’s essential to understand what “10W” means. The term “W” stands for watts, which is a unit of power. In audio equipment, wattage indicates how much power a speaker can handle and is a crucial factor in determining loudness and audio clarity.

The Relationship Between Power and Loudness

The relationship between wattage and perceived loudness is not linear. In simple terms:

  • Doubling the wattage can lead to an increase in loudness of about 3 dB.
  • A 10W speaker might be perceived as about 3 dB louder than a 5W speaker, but that does not necessarily mean it will be loud enough to fill a larger space.

Understanding Decibels (dB)

Decibels (dB) are the standard unit of measurement for sound intensity. Here are some essential points regarding sound levels:

  • 0 dB: Hearing threshold
  • 30 dB: Quiet whisper
  • 60 dB: Normal conversation
  • 85 dB: Threshold for hearing damage after prolonged exposure
  • 120 dB: Jet takeoff

Given this scale, a 10W speaker can typically produce sounds around 85 dB to 95 dB depending on its design and efficiency, which can indeed be loud for smaller spaces or personal use.

Factors Affecting Loudness

While wattage plays a significant role in loudness, several other factors also contribute:

Speaker Efficiency

Speaker efficiency refers to how effectively a speaker converts power (watts) into sound output (decibels). A high-efficiency speaker will produce more sound from the same amount of power compared to a lower-efficiency model. The general formula for speaker efficiency is:

  • An efficient speaker (around 90 dB at 1W/1m) can achieve loudness levels that are sufficient for many casual applications. A 10W power input could potentially make it reach 100 dB, making it perfect for parties or outdoor events.

Speaker Size and Design

The size and design of a speaker also significantly impact loudness. Larger speakers often produce better bass sounds and can project sound over a broader area compared to smaller ones. The design, including the type of drivers used (woofers, tweeters), determines how well it can handle various frequencies, which affects overall performance.

Room Acoustics

The space where the speaker is used can dramatically influence sound perception. If a 10W speaker is placed in a small, carpeted room, it may seem much louder than it would in a large, empty hall. Speaker placement, room shape, and even the furnishings can alter sound pressure levels.

How loud is a 10W speaker compared to other wattage speakers?

The loudness of a speaker is commonly measured in decibels (dB), and while wattage plays a role, it’s not the sole determinant of how loud a speaker can get. Generally, doubling the wattage results in an increase of about 3 dB, which is a noticeable change in loudness. Thus, a 10W speaker will typically be quieter than a 20W speaker, but the difference may not be overwhelmingly significant.

In everyday scenarios, a 10W speaker can deliver adequate sound for small gatherings or personal enjoyment, but it may struggle in larger rooms or outdoor settings. It can compete with louder speakers at lower volumes, but for those seeking high volume levels in such environments, higher wattage options may prove necessary.

How can I maximize the performance of a 10W speaker?

To maximize the performance of a 10W speaker, consider optimizing its placement within your space. Position the speaker close to walls or corners can enhance sound projection and create a fuller listening experience. Make sure the speaker is at ear level while seated for optimal sound dispersion, which can significantly improve audio clarity and impact.

Additionally, controlling the environment can help as well. Reducing background noise by turning off other electronics or using sound-absorbing materials can enhance the perceived loudness and quality of the audio. Finally, pairing your speaker with a quality audio source and ensuring that the audio settings are well-adjusted can also make a significant difference in overall performance.
